1. Start with a Well-Defined Structural Template
Before modeling any structural elements, Autodesk experts recommend setting up a clean and consistent structural template. Define levels, grids, structural families, and view templates early. A proper Revit structural template ensures accuracy and saves time throughout the project lifecycle.
2. Use Correct Structural Families
Always use Revit families specifically designed for structural modeling, such as beams, columns, slabs, and foundations. Using correct structural families in Revit improves analysis accuracy and prevents issues during documentation and coordination with other disciplines.
3. Maintain Model Accuracy with Analytical Models
Autodesk experts emphasize the importance of aligning the physical model with the analytical model. Regularly check analytical lines, supports, and load paths to ensure your Revit structural analytical model is ready for structural analysis and export to engineering software.
4. Apply Consistent Naming and Parameters
Consistent naming conventions and shared parameters help improve collaboration in BIM projects. Clear parameter management allows structural engineers to control quantities, schedules, and documentation efficiently within Revit Structure.
5. Optimize Performance for Large Structural Models
For large projects, Autodesk experts recommend using worksets, model groups, and view filters strategically. Keeping your Revit structural model lightweight improves performance and reduces errors during teamwork and cloud collaboration.
6. Coordinate Early with Other Disciplines
Early coordination with architectural and MEP models helps avoid clashes and redesign work. Use interference checks and BIM coordination tools to ensure your structural modeling in Revit aligns perfectly with the overall project design.
